Coronavirus Scotland: Police fine 7000 lockdown rule breakers as patrols on roads to be ramped up

More than 7000 Covid-19 rule breakers have been fined by police since the start of the pandemic.

Police Scotland Chief Constable Iain Livingstone says his officers have spoken to the public a huge 100,000 times about the restrictions, while issuing thousands of fixed penalties.

Almost 550 people have been arrested, with officers intervening at "over 350 different premises".

The details were announced as Chief Constable Livingstone confirmed police presence would be "maximised" in communities and on roads in order to deter those who might be thinking of breaking the rules.

He said: "Since the start of the pandemic officers across Scotland have had over 100,000 interactions with their fellow members of the public regarding coronavirus compliance.

"We've issued over 7000 fixed penalties, and made almost 550 arrests. In addition to that we've made over 350 interventions at different premises, and closed around 90 of them."

He added: "I will maximise visible policing presence in our communities, and on our roads. I'll do that to help people, to offer reassurance, but also to act as a deterrent to those who may be thinking of breaching restrictions.

"Although the restrictions have changed again, and they are very strict, as they have done often and at times quickly, the response of Police Scotland will not change. Our response has been and will remain proportionate, reasonable and fair, underpinned by the principle of consent.

"Where officers encounter wilful and blatant offences, we will continue to act decisively to enforce the law."
